ABSTRACT:
The present invention provides a method of inhibiting l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-mediated stimulation of cells. This method comprises contacting the cells, in the presence of a cell-stimulating amount of lipopolysaccharide, with Bactericidal/Permeability Increasing Protein (BPI) in an amount effective to inhibit cell stimulation.
